What Is Bespoke Furniture?

Unlike mass-produced options, bespoke furniture reflects individuality and craftsmanship.

From dining tables and wardrobes to armchairs and shelving, each design is created for the space it will live in.

Craftsmanship and Materials

Bespoke furniture is defined by its craftsmanship.

Others use rare veneers, metals, or fabrics to create one-of-a-kind luxury items.

While flat-pack furniture might be built in hours, custom furniture can take weeks or even months to perfect.
